The 12GW6 (also labelled 12DQ6B) is a television line output valve designed for the American 525 line 30 fps system.
The data-sheet also gives details for use as a Class A amplifier.
The Sylvania name and Made in USA. This image was taken looking at the working face of the anode where the side flange is present both for fixing and to offer extra cooling.
Looking along the grid axis. The inner wire grids are just visible and extending above and below the anode is the bright beam plate.
Here the glass foot can be seen. The valve is basically of all glass construction with wires soldered to the IO base pins.
The wide glass tube envelope is 38 mm in diameter and, excluding the IO base pins, is 92 mm tall.
References: Data-sheet. Type 12GW6 was first introduced in 1956. See also 1956 adverts.
